Step 1: Emergency Response
Within 60 minutes of your call, our technicians will arrive at your property to assess the damage and begin the restoration process. They’ll use specialized equipment to extract water and prevent further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ove standing water from your property. This is a critical step in preventing mold and bacterial grow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idifying
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your space, ensuring that your property is completely dry and safe. This may take 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once your property is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ize all affected areas to prevent mold and bacterial growth. This includes walls, floors, and any personal belongings.
Step 5: Final Inspection
Our team will con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that your property is completely restored and safe. We’ll also provide you with a detailed report of the work we’ve done.

Apartment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ak from a faucet | Yes | No | DIY repairs can be done quickly and easily. |
| Large water leak from a burst pipe | No | Yes | A professional can extract water and dry the area quickly and efficiently. |
| Water damage from a flooded apartment | No | Yes | A professional can handle the cleanup and restoration process, including drying, cleaning, and sanitizing. |
| Water damage from a roof leak | No | Yes | A professional can inspect the roof and make necessary repairs to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age from a frozen pipe | No | Yes | A professional can thaw the pipe and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age from a natural disaster | No | Yes | A professional can handle the cleanup and restoration process, including drying, cleaning, and sanitizing. |

Apartment Water Damage Restoration Cost In Robie Creek North, ID
The cost of Apartment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Robie Creek North, ID. These are estimates, not guarantees, and ex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and are happy to provide you with a detailed breakdown of the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
| Equipment rental and usage |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, duration of restoration process |
| Dehumidifying and ventilation |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of humidity |
| Final inspection and report |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, complexity of restoration process |
| More services (e.g. Mold remediation, content cleaning) | $500 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, scope of work |
